Maestro Technology Sells Used Drives as New

Maestro Technology sells used drives as new (2025-04-30)

At rsync.net we have trusted suppliers with verified supply chains and a long history of providing reliable service.

However, from time to time, it is worth purchasing parts from Amazon – something we do with caution and skepticism.

On or about April 22nd of 2025, we purchased four SSD chunks from “Maestro Technology” for use in the ZFS “special” metadata device.

This is important because even though the four SSDs that we typically add as “special” devices to a Zoolpool are a small addition to the 60 drive Zoolpool, losing the “special” device means losing the entire Zoolpool.

For this reason it is extremely important that the SSD parts we start with are in perfect, new, unworn condition – if their lifespan is reduced it could be a disaster.

Here is the Smart Data for the Intel SSD D3-S4510 SSDSC2KB038T801 3.84TB which was advertised and sold as brand new by Maestro Technology:

These are old, used drives that have been in use for about three years.

This is especially troubling because the intended duty cycle of these parts is intensive and we will probably exhaust the remaining writes on these SSDs in less than two years.

For comparison, here’s what this exact part looks like when it’s actually new:

Remember: workload_minutes defaults to 65535 (0xffff) until the workload timer reaches 60 minutes…

There is very little we can do in response to this seller selling old, used parts as brand new.

Our only other recourse, other than returning the four parts for a refund (which we did) and documenting this behavior here, was Guarantee These four specific parts were never again sold as new:
